Paint Your Own Pet (Acrylic Portrait Workshop)

This is the class for people who say: “I can’t draw… but I REALLY want to paint my pet.”

You bring a pet photo, we’ll print it, help you trace it using carbon paper, and then we’ll paint your pet step-by-step in acrylic. Beginner-friendly, structured, and surprisingly relaxing.


What to bring (important)

Bring 1 clear photo of your pet (phone is fine). Best photos:

  • Good lighting, face clearly visible
  • Eyes sharp (not blurry)
  • Simple background (or we can simplify it)

If you can, bring 2–3 options—we’ll pick the best one together.


Part 1 — Setup + Tracing (no drawing stress)

You’ll learn:

  • How we prep and print your photo
  • How to trace cleanly using carbon paper
  • How to simplify shapes so the painting stays fun (not painful)

Part 2 — Painting Your Pet (step-by-step acrylic)

We’ll guide you through:

  • Blocking in big shapes (fur, face, background)
  • Mixing your pet’s colors (warm/cool browns, blacks, whites, grays, etc.)
  • Building fur texture with simple brush moves
  • Bringing the eyes to life (the “magic” moment)
  • Finishing touches and highlights

You’ll leave with a finished pet portrait or very close to finished (depending on pace).
